[Desktop-packages] [Bug 1227824] Re: please add trust-store integration to e-d-s for calendar API

2016-08-03 Thread Kugi Eusebio
This bug is quite old and I think in need of urgency.
There are apps that would like to use the calendar API like Alarm and Reminders 
but cannot because of this bug (me included :) ).
Also, the documentation in the developer site needs to indicate that developers 
cannot freely use them as of the moment. The Alarm and AlarmModel have been 
listed in the components and there's no mention that the calendar policy is 
needed and that it is still in "reserved" status.

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to evolution-data-server in Ubuntu.
https://bugs.launchpad.net/bugs/1227824

Title:
  please add trust-store integration to e-d-s for calendar API

Status in apparmor-easyprof-ubuntu package in Ubuntu:
  Confirmed
Status in evolution-data-server package in Ubuntu:
  Confirmed
Status in apparmor-easyprof-ubuntu source package in Saucy:
  Won't Fix
Status in evolution-data-server source package in Saucy:
  Won't Fix
Status in apparmor-easyprof-ubuntu source package in Trusty:
  Won't Fix
Status in evolution-data-server source package in Trusty:
  Won't Fix

Bug description:
  Currently the 'calendar' policy group is reserved because giving
  access to the EDS's DBus API allows applications to access all
  calendars without user consent. If calendars are going to be made
  generally available to untrusted appstore apps, EDS needs to be
  modified to use trust-store, like location-service does. Integrating
  with trust-store means that when an app tries to connect to the EDS
  over DBus, EDS will contact trust-store, the trust-store will prompt
  the user ("Foo wants to access your calendars. Is this ok? Yes|No"),
  optionally cache the result and return the result to EDS. In this
  manner the user is given a contextual prompt at the time of access by
  the app. Using caching this decision can be remembered the next time.
  If caching is used, there should be a method to change the decision in
  settings.

  Targeting to T-Series for now, since the trust-store is not in a
  reusable form yet.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apparmor-easyprof-ubuntu/+bug/1227824/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to : desktop-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p


[Desktop-packages] [Bug 1227824] Re: please add trust-store integration to e-d-s for calendar API

2016-07-31 Thread Launchpad Bug Tracker
Status changed to 'Confirmed' because the bug affects multiple users.

** Changed in: evolution-data-server (Ubuntu)
   Status: New => Confirmed

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to evolution-data-server in Ubuntu.
https://bugs.launchpad.net/bugs/1227824

Title:
  please add trust-store integration to e-d-s for calendar API

Status in apparmor-easyprof-ubuntu package in Ubuntu:
  Confirmed
Status in evolution-data-server package in Ubuntu:
  Confirmed
Status in apparmor-easyprof-ubuntu source package in Saucy:
  Won't Fix
Status in evolution-data-server source package in Saucy:
  Won't Fix
Status in apparmor-easyprof-ubuntu source package in Trusty:
  Won't Fix
Status in evolution-data-server source package in Trusty:
  Won't Fix

Bug description:
  Currently the 'calendar' policy group is reserved because giving
  access to the EDS's DBus API allows applications to access all
  calendars without user consent. If calendars are going to be made
  generally available to untrusted appstore apps, EDS needs to be
  modified to use trust-store, like location-service does. Integrating
  with trust-store means that when an app tries to connect to the EDS
  over DBus, EDS will contact trust-store, the trust-store will prompt
  the user ("Foo wants to access your calendars. Is this ok? Yes|No"),
  optionally cache the result and return the result to EDS. In this
  manner the user is given a contextual prompt at the time of access by
  the app. Using caching this decision can be remembered the next time.
  If caching is used, there should be a method to change the decision in
  settings.

  Targeting to T-Series for now, since the trust-store is not in a
  reusable form yet.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apparmor-easyprof-ubuntu/+bug/1227824/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to : desktop-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p


[Desktop-packages] [Bug 1227824] Re: please add trust-store integration to e-d-s for calendar API

2015-05-12 Thread Jamie Strandboge
FYI, apps are coming in that are trying to use the Alarms functionality
of the calendar and acceptance into the store is problematic due to the
lack of this feature.

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to evolution-data-server in Ubuntu.
https://bugs.launchpad.net/bugs/1227824

Title:
  please add trust-store integration to e-d-s for calendar API

Status in apparmor-easyprof-ubuntu package in Ubuntu:
  Confirmed
Status in evolution-data-server package in Ubuntu:
  New
Status in apparmor-easyprof-ubuntu source package in Saucy:
  Won't Fix
Status in evolution-data-server source package in Saucy:
  Won't Fix
Status in apparmor-easyprof-ubuntu source package in Trusty:
  Won't Fix
Status in evolution-data-server source package in Trusty:
  Won't Fix

Bug description:
  Currently the 'calendar' policy group is reserved because giving
  access to the EDS's DBus API allows applications to access all
  calendars without user consent. If calendars are going to be made
  generally available to untrusted appstore apps, EDS needs to be
  modified to use trust-store, like location-service does. Integrating
  with trust-store means that when an app tries to connect to the EDS
  over DBus, EDS will contact trust-store, the trust-store will prompt
  the user (Foo wants to access your calendars. Is this ok? Yes|No),
  optionally cache the result and return the result to EDS. In this
  manner the user is given a contextual prompt at the time of access by
  the app. Using caching this decision can be remembered the next time.
  If caching is used, there should be a method to change the decision in
  settings.

  Targeting to T-Series for now, since the trust-store is not in a
  reusable form yet.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apparmor-easyprof-ubuntu/+bug/1227824/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to : desktop-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p


[Desktop-packages] [Bug 1227824] Re: please add trust-store integration to e-d-s for calendar API

2014-11-03 Thread Jamie Strandboge
** Changed in: apparmor-easyprof-ubuntu (Ubuntu)
   Status: New = Confirmed

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to evolution-data-server in Ubuntu.
https://bugs.launchpad.net/bugs/1227824

Title:
  please add trust-store integration to e-d-s for calendar API

Status in “apparmor-easyprof-ubuntu” package in Ubuntu:
  Confirmed
Status in “evolution-data-server” package in Ubuntu:
  New
Status in “apparmor-easyprof-ubuntu” source package in Saucy:
  Won't Fix
Status in “evolution-data-server” source package in Saucy:
  Won't Fix
Status in “apparmor-easyprof-ubuntu” source package in Trusty:
  Won't Fix
Status in “evolution-data-server” source package in Trusty:
  Won't Fix

Bug description:
  Currently the 'calendar' policy group is reserved because giving
  access to the EDS's DBus API allows applications to access all
  calendars without user consent. If calendars are going to be made
  generally available to untrusted appstore apps, EDS needs to be
  modified to use trust-store, like location-service does. Integrating
  with trust-store means that when an app tries to connect to the EDS
  over DBus, EDS will contact trust-store, the trust-store will prompt
  the user (Foo wants to access your calendars. Is this ok? Yes|No),
  optionally cache the result and return the result to EDS. In this
  manner the user is given a contextual prompt at the time of access by
  the app. Using caching this decision can be remembered the next time.
  If caching is used, there should be a method to change the decision in
  settings.

  Targeting to T-Series for now, since the trust-store is not in a
  reusable form yet.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apparmor-easyprof-ubuntu/+bug/1227824/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to : desktop-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p


[Desktop-packages] [Bug 1227824] Re: please add trust-store integration to e-d-s

2014-06-17 Thread Jamie Strandboge
Per meeting today, trust-store integration for e-d-s is not for RTM.
Furthermore, supporting a global calendar for apps at all is still in
discussion.

** Summary changed:

- please integrate with trust-store
+ please add trust-store integration to e-d-s

** Changed in: evolution-data-server (Ubuntu Trusty)
   Status: New = Won't Fix

** Changed in: apparmor-easyprof-ubuntu (Ubuntu Trusty)
   Status: Triaged = Won't Fix

** Changed in: evolution-data-server (Ubuntu)
   Importance: Undecided = Wishlist

** Changed in: apparmor-easyprof-ubuntu (Ubuntu)
   Importance: Undecided = Wishlist

** Summary changed:

- please add trust-store integration to e-d-s
+ please add trust-store integration to e-d-s for calendar API

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to evolution-data-server in Ubuntu.
https://bugs.launchpad.net/bugs/1227824

Title:
  please add trust-store integration to e-d-s for calendar API

Status in “apparmor-easyprof-ubuntu” package in Ubuntu:
  New
Status in “evolution-data-server” package in Ubuntu:
  New
Status in “apparmor-easyprof-ubuntu” source package in Saucy:
  Won't Fix
Status in “evolution-data-server” source package in Saucy:
  Won't Fix
Status in “apparmor-easyprof-ubuntu” source package in Trusty:
  Won't Fix
Status in “evolution-data-server” source package in Trusty:
  Won't Fix

Bug description:
  Currently the 'calendar' policy group is reserved because giving
  access to the EDS's DBus API allows applications to access all
  calendars without user consent. If calendars are going to be made
  generally available to untrusted appstore apps, EDS needs to be
  modified to use trust-store, like location-service does. Integrating
  with trust-store means that when an app tries to connect to the EDS
  over DBus, EDS will contact trust-store, the trust-store will prompt
  the user (Foo wants to access your calendars. Is this ok? Yes|No),
  optionally cache the result and return the result to EDS. In this
  manner the user is given a contextual prompt at the time of access by
  the app. Using caching this decision can be remembered the next time.
  If caching is used, there should be a method to change the decision in
  settings.

  Targeting to T-Series for now, since the trust-store is not in a
  reusable form yet.

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/apparmor-easyprof-ubuntu/+bug/1227824/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to : desktop-packages@lists.launchpad.net
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p